Carnegie Library of Pittsburgh workers join United Steel Workers Union


 


On Wed., Aug. 14, Carnegie Library of Pittsburgh workers voted overwhelmingly to join the United Steelworkers (USW) union, with over 60 percent of combined staff – including librarians and library assistants, clerks, and IT professionals – casting favorable ballots. The results came just months after the CLP system launched their organizing campaign in June.
